- The distance between Boerne, Tx, Usa and Moosonee, Ontario, Canada is approximately 2,822 km or 1,754 mi.
- To reach Boerne, Tx in this distance one would set out from Moosonee, Ontario bearing 219°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Boerne, Tx bearing 207° or SSW .
- Boerne,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Moosonee, Ontario has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Boerne,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Moosonee, Ontario is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 19.6 °C (35.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.4 °C (29.5°F) less in Boerne, Tx.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 168.9 mm (6.6 in) more which is equivalent to 168.9 l/m² (4.15 US gal/ft²) or 1,689,000 l/ha (180,565 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.5° higher in Boerne, Tx than in Moosonee, Ontario.
